O problema aqui é que o seu diretório $HOME
pertence a root
(o OP colou isso em bate-papo ):
$ ls -l /home
total 20 drwxr-xr-x 2 root root 4096 Oct 13 18:38 cloudcoder2000 drwx------ 2 root root
Portanto, você não tem acesso de gravação ao seu $HOME
, o que significa que o X não pode criar um arquivo $HOME/.Xinit
e está dando o erro que você vê. Os seguintes comandos devem corrigir:
sudo rm ~/.Xauthority
sudo chown cloudcoder2000:cloudcoder2000 ~/
Agora você pode adicionar esta linha ao seu ~/.xinitrc
(este comando criará o arquivo se ele não existir):
echo "exec fwvm" >> ~/.xinitrc
Agora, a execução de startx
deve iniciar uma sessão fwvm
.